RedMagic has formally launched the RedMagic 11 Air, a brand new gaming smartphone designed to mix excessive efficiency with an ultra-thin physique. Following a number of teasers, the successor of the Redmagic 10 Air was launched on Tuesday (20) and brings notable upgrades over its predecessor, together with a extra highly effective chipset, a sooner show, and a bigger battery.
Regardless of its slim profile, one of many cellphone’s major highlights is the inclusion of RedMagic’s signature lively cooling system with a built-in fan, a characteristic usually present in thicker gaming-focused fashions.
By way of design, the RedMagic 11 Air retains the model’s aggressive gamer aesthetic, with sharp edges and a futuristic look. Black and white coloration choices characteristic clear accents, whereas the show is surrounded by extraordinarily skinny bezels. The cellphone measures 7.85 mm thick, making it slimmer than the RedMagic 11 Professional, which has a thicker 8.9 mm physique.
Efficiency is pushed by the Snapdragon 8 Elite, an improve in comparison with the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 used within the earlier Air mannequin. The chipset is paired with as much as 16GB of LPDDR5X Extremely RAM and as much as 512GB of UFS 4.1 storage, providing sufficient energy for demanding apps and high-end video games. Extra efficiency help comes from the RedCore R4 coprocessor, designed to optimize gaming duties, and a complicated cooling answer that mixes a vapor chamber with a fan for the primary time within the Air sequence.

The show is a 6.85-inch OLED panel with 1.5K-class decision (2688 x 1216) and a 144Hz refresh charge. It additionally contains 960Hz contact sampling for sooner enter response and stereo audio.
Digicam {hardware} is purposeful moderately than flagship-focused, with a 16MP under-display selfie digicam and two rear sensors: a 50MP major digicam and an 8MP ultrawide.
Battery capability will increase considerably to 7,000mAh, up from 6,000mAh, and helps 120W quick charging, aimed toward prolonged gaming classes with shorter charging breaks. Connectivity contains 5G, Wi-Fi 7, Bluetooth 5.4, NFC, and an infrared blaster, together with an in-display fingerprint sensor and customizable capacitive gaming triggers. The cellphone runs Android 16 with RedMagic OS 11.

In China, the RedMagic 11 Air begins at 3,699 yuan (~$530) for 12GB/256GB and 4,399 yuan (~$631) for 16GB/512GB. World availability has not been confirmed but.
